Ömürbek Babanov, born on May twentieth, nineteen seventy, is a prominent Kyrgyz entrepreneur and politician. He has made significant contributions to the business landscape of Kyrgyzstan, notably as the owner of Mbank and Asia Cement. His ventures have established him as a key player in the region's economic development.
In addition to his business achievements, Babanov has also held a notable political position, serving as the Prime Minister of Kyrgyzstan on two occasions, albeit briefly, from two thousand eleven to two thousand twelve.
